Spain - to do list
Santiago Bernabéu Stadium is one of Spain - to do list.

1. Santiago Bernabéu Stadium

9.0
(Estadio Santiago Bernabéu)
Av. de Concha Espina, 1 (P. de La Castellana), Madrid, Comunidad de Madrid
Soccer Stadium · Nueva España · 1130 tips and reviews
Puerta del Sol is one of Spain - to do list.

2. Puerta del Sol

9.1
Pl. Puerta del Sol, Madrid, Comunidad de Madrid
Plaza · 704 tips and reviews
Plaza Mayor is one of Spain - to do list.

3. Plaza Mayor

9.1
Pl. Mayor, Madrid, Comunidad de Madrid
Plaza · Plaza Mayor · 478 tips and reviews
Plaza de Cibeles is one of Spain - to do list.

4. Plaza de Cibeles

9.3
Pl. de Cibeles, Madrid, Comunidad de Madrid
Plaza · 215 tips and reviews
Westfield Parquesur is one of Spain - to do list.

5. Westfield Parquesur

7.9
Av. Gran Bretaña, s/n, Leganés, Comunidad de Madrid
Shopping Mall · 101 tips and reviews
Casa Labra is one of Spain - to do list.

6. Casa Labra

8.5
C. Tetuán, 12, Madrid, Comunidad de Madrid
Tapas Restaurant · Sol · 211 tips and reviews